The High Efficiency Nebulizer (HEN)<br />

The HEN is especially well-suited <strong>for</strong> microsample analysis in µHPLC, CE, CIC <strong>and</strong> FIA. It exhibits detection limits<br />

comparable to those of a st<strong>and</strong>ard MEINHARD ® nebulizer while consuming 25 times less sample (see table). It is<br />

designed to operate at 1 L/min argon <strong>and</strong> ~170 psig. The HEN can function reliability at liquid flow rates from 10 to<br />

1200 µL/min. The HEN fits st<strong>and</strong>ard spray chambers. The high-pressure fitting (Fit Kit #2) is recommended <strong>for</strong><br />

secure attachment of the nebulizer gas tubing. Chromatography unions (Fit Kits #1 <strong>and</strong> #1-Micro) are available to<br />

provide a minimum dead volume, leak-free connection to 1/16” column tubing. To order, request model HEN-170-<br />

AA.<br />

The Direct Injection High Efficiency Nebulizer (DIHEN)<br />

The DIHEN is a pneumatic micronebulizer designed to introduce micro-volumes of sample solutions directly into an<br />

inductively coupled plasma (<strong>ICP</strong>) or inductively coupled plasma mass spectrometer (<strong>ICP</strong>MS). The DIHEN-<strong>ICP</strong>MS<br />

approach is particularly well suited <strong>for</strong> ultratrace isotope <strong>and</strong> elemental analysis of sample types that are of limited<br />

volume, toxic, or expensive, or that exhibit speciation interferences. The DIHEN may be used as a micronebulizer in<br />

other atomic spectroscopy techniques such as flame photometry.<br />

Two accessories well-suited <strong>for</strong> the DIHEN: The chromatography union, Fit Kit #1-Micro, is an easy <strong>and</strong> convenient<br />

method to reduce dead volume in the sample introduction system to less than 10 µL. The high pressure reducing<br />

union, Fit Kit #2, allows easy connection of a high-pressure Argon line to the sidearm of the DIHEN.<br />

Advantages of the DIHEN: The advantages of the DIHEN are its ability to introduce microvolumes into plasmas at 1-<br />

100 µL/min, with relatively small aerosol droplet size, <strong>and</strong> with nearly 100% use of the sample. It is also highly<br />

suitable <strong>for</strong> the analysis of volatile solvents, avoiding interferences which occur in conventional spray chambers.<br />

These <strong>and</strong> other characteristics of the DIHEN can be found in an Analytical Chemistry article titled: “A Direct Injection<br />

High-Efficiency Nebulizer <strong>for</strong> Inductively Coupled Plasma Mass Spectrometry,” J.A. McLean, Hao Zhang, <strong>and</strong> Akbar<br />

Montaser, Anal. Chem. 1998, 70, 1012-1020.<br />

NEBULIZER OPERATION:<br />

The MEINHARD ® nebulizer will aspirate liquid sample naturally when the rated flow of gas is directed into the<br />

sidearm <strong>and</strong> a sample feed is connected to the liquid input. All models may be operated with externally<br />

pumped analyte provided the sample flow is not significantly below the natural aspiration rate. Calibrations<br />

reflect a st<strong>and</strong>ard operational reference <strong>and</strong> are not intended as limitations on conditions of use, which can<br />

vary widely. Operation can be optimized <strong>for</strong> specific instruments.<br />

The PC3 is a small, simple, <strong>and</strong> robust cooler <strong>for</strong> <strong>ICP</strong>-MS <strong>and</strong> <strong>ICP</strong>-0ES cyclonic spray chambers. The PC3 cools<br />

the outer walls of the cyclonic spray chamber to a constant temperature enhancing long-term signal stability,<br />

reducing polyatomic ion interferences such as oxides <strong>and</strong> reducing solvent loading especially when volatile organic<br />

solvents are analyzed. The cyclonic spray chamber offers the advantages of low memory effects, fast rinse-out<br />

<strong>and</strong>, in many cases, higher sample transport efficiency.<br />

Apex High-Sensitivity System<br />

Elemental Scientific has designed the new Apex family of high sensitivity <strong>and</strong> low background<br />

sample introduction systems to increase signal intensity while often reducing relative<br />

background contamination <strong>for</strong> <strong>ICP</strong>MS <strong>and</strong> <strong>ICP</strong>AES analyses. The Apex improves sensitivity<br />

primarily by increasing both sample transport efficiency <strong>and</strong> the quality of aerosol introduced to<br />

the <strong>ICP</strong> instrument. The Apex controls background contamination by employing high-purity,<br />

inert, <strong>and</strong> o-ring-free wetted surfaces. When combined with a self-aspirating MicroFlow PFA<br />

nebulizer even aggressive <strong>and</strong> concentrated chemicals may be analyzed at very high sensitivity<br />

<strong>and</strong> very low contamination.<br />

Apex Q High-Sensitivity System<br />

The Apex may be used with nebulizers operating over a wide range of sample flow rates from 20<br />

µL/min to over 1 mL/min. The nebulizers may be either self-aspirated or pumped.<br />

Operation<br />

Liquid samples are nebulized into a patent-pending spray chamber <strong>and</strong> desolvation system where<br />

the sample aerosol is efficiently conditioned to produce an intense <strong>and</strong> uni<strong>for</strong>m aerosol that is<br />

transported to the <strong>ICP</strong>.<br />

When compared to conventional <strong>ICP</strong>MS sample introduction systems the Apex will typically<br />

increase <strong>ICP</strong>MS sensitivity by approximately 10x when using a 300 µL/min nebulizer <strong>and</strong> by<br />

approximately 3x when using a 100 µL/min nebulizer. These improvement factors are in spite of<br />

the lower Apex sample consumption rate. <strong>ICP</strong>-MS detection limits are in the sub-ppt to sub-ppq<br />

range <strong>for</strong> most elements.<br />

<strong>ICP</strong>AES detection limits can be improved by up to a factor of 6-10 when operating at 1 ml/min<br />

using a MicroFlow PFA or PolyPro ST nebulizer together with the Apex. Alternatively, the<br />

combination of a low flow nebulizer with the Apex maintains <strong>ICP</strong>-AES sensitivity while reducing<br />

sample consumption by a factor of 5 to 10, improving <strong>ICP</strong>-AES determinations when the volume<br />

of sample is limited.

Membrane Desolvation<br />

An optional ACM Nafion fluoropolymer membrane desolvation module is available to remove<br />

residual solvent vapor in the sample aerosol stream. The ACM membrane module may be used<br />

with any of the <strong>ICP</strong>-MS Apex models. The membrane module is easily demounted <strong>for</strong> the Apex<br />

exit port. This feature allows the Apex to be used either with or without a membrane to best suit<br />

specific analytical applications.<br />

ACM Membrane is easily<br />

attached or detached<br />

With the ACM membrane desolvation module oxides <strong>and</strong> other <strong>ICP</strong>-MS interferences are further<br />

reduced. For example, CeO+/Ce+ was reduced to < 0.1% when using the Apex with membrane<br />

desolvation.<br />

6. Operation<br />

The Perimax 12 peristaltic pump is very simple to operate. The pump tubing is placed around the pump head <strong>and</strong> secured<br />

at each end in a tubing retainer. Pressure against the tubing in each channel is adjusted with a fine screw on the pressure<br />

bracket. Function keys are provided <strong>for</strong> ON/OFF <strong>and</strong> RIGHT/LEFT rotation. The rotational speed of the pump head is<br />

continuously adjustable via a 10-turn potentiometer. The digital indicator (0-999) ensures a reproducible speed setting<br />

<strong>and</strong>, there<strong>for</strong>e, a precise flow rate. A high-speed key provides <strong>for</strong> brief operation at maximum speed, <strong>for</strong> example, to<br />

obtain fast wash-out of the tubing when changing to another liquid.<br />

Perimax 16 Antipuls Pump Head<br />

The 16-roller pump head consists of two half-channels of 8 rollers each in which the rollers are arranged with a 180-<br />

degree phase displacement. A piece of pump tubing is inserted into each half-channel; downstream from the pump head,<br />

a Y-fitting combines the half-channels. Consequently, a peak in one half-channel is cancelled by a trough in the parallel<br />

half-channel so that the combined flow produced is completely pulsation-free. The Perimax 16/2 can be operated with 2<br />

pulse-free channels, 4 pulsating channels, or one pulse-free <strong>and</strong> 2 pulsating channels. Also available are the Perimax<br />

16/1 <strong>and</strong> Perimax 16/3.<br />

Sets of pre-assembled pump tubing are available in a variety of sizes <strong>for</strong> the Perimax 16 Antipuls. A Y-fitting splits the<br />

flow between two half-channels; a second Y-fitting recombines the flows downstream.

Aerosol-to-Liquid Particle eXtraction System - ALPXS<br />

Principle of Operation<br />

Air is drawn into the ionization chamber.<br />

Particles assume a negative charge.<br />

Collection electrode is maintained at<br />

positive high voltage <strong>and</strong> particles are<br />

attracted to it.<br />

As the particles migrate towards the<br />

collection electrode they are trapped by<br />

the liquid layer that continuously washes<br />

the surface of the collection electrode <strong>and</strong><br />

accumulate.<br />

An auxiliary pump transports a very small<br />

fraction of the reservoir volume to an<br />

<strong>ICP</strong>MS, <strong>ICP</strong>-OES or AA <strong>for</strong> determination of<br />

metal species in the liquid.<br />

Developed at the Institute of Physics of the Earth (Paris, France), the primary function of the EVAPOCLEAN is<br />

to preconcentrate various chemical solutions under controlled conditions. Evaporation (at temperatures up<br />

to 250 °C) <strong>and</strong> immediate condensation occur in a closed system that does not exchange with laboratory<br />

air.<br />

The EVAPOCLEAN device allows the analyst to process organic solvents, aqueous solutions, acidic <strong>and</strong><br />

alkaline solutions, <strong>and</strong> concentrated solutions which derive from the dissolution of various materials with<br />

aggressive reagents (HF, HCl, HBr, HNO 3<br />

, HClO 4<br />

, H 2<br />

S0 4<br />

, H 2<br />

O 2<br />

, NH 4<br />

OH). Applications include raw<br />

materials (rocks, minerals, ores, natural waters), industrial <strong>and</strong> advanced materials (cements, metals, glass<br />

products, ceramics), as well as basic chemicals <strong>for</strong> industry, highly pure chemicals, <strong>and</strong> liquid <strong>and</strong> solid<br />

wastes.<br />

EVAPOCLEAN devices are also designed <strong>for</strong> trace <strong>and</strong> ultra-trace element analyses which require a<br />

cleanroom environment. Evaporation-condensation cells are made with non-contaminating, corrosionresistant,<br />

high-purity grade fluoropolymer materials, machined under controlled conditions. They do not<br />

emit dust particles.<br />

Depending on the EVAPOCLEAN model that is chosen, 1 to 12 samples can be processed simultaneously or<br />

independently, without risk of cross-contamination. It is possible to evaporate to dryness or to leave a small<br />

residual volume of the evaporating liquid, to concentrate solutions, <strong>and</strong> to purify liquid reagents.<br />

The top face of EVAPOCLEAN devices is equipped with ports to allow acid digestion of samples <strong>and</strong><br />

cleaning of jars by reflux of acid vapor or water vapor in the closed container.<br />

The basic EVAPOCLEAN incorporates a simple controller which raises the block temperature to a specified<br />

temperature <strong>and</strong> holds the temperature <strong>for</strong> a specified period, after which the EVAPOCLEAN will cool to<br />

ambient temperature. An optional programmable controller stores up to four programs of sixteen<br />

segments each.

MINI VESSEL CLEANER<br />

Analysis <strong>for</strong> trace <strong>and</strong> ultra trace species requires<br />

appropriate cleaning of sample vessels.<br />

How does it work ?<br />

Vapor rises from the bath <strong>and</strong> condenses on the vessels;<br />

droplets carrying impurities return to the acid bath.<br />

containers<br />

Acid bath<br />

PTFE support<br />

vapor droplets<br />

Acid-resistant Hot Plate<br />

Principle:<br />

Cleaning is accomplished by<br />

convection <strong>and</strong> condensation<br />

of high purity acid vapors.<br />

The process offers a very<br />

high level of purity that<br />

cannot be obtained by<br />

immersion in a bath.<br />
